Output 7548687208244770b518dba71120e5369966f0ca695fde654553b0a0baa27c2a:59

value
127000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72cb408687838988566b4e92e935524e3d3e0f54 OP_EQUAL
address
3C9zScV8KEzwMhhiQbZUTH9SJR8BvfJbj1
transaction
7548687208244770b518dba71120e5369966f0ca695fde654553b0a0baa27c2a
spent
true